Booking: From 19:15 (BST) (60 mins)
Practice: 20:15 (15 mins)
Qual: 20:30 (15 mins)
Race: 20:45 8 Laps (approx 30 mins)

Cars allowed:
SLS GT3, McLaren GT3, Z4 GT3, Nissan GTR GT3

Track: Le Mans http://www.racedepartment.com/downloads/circuit-de-la-sarthe.2482/
Time of Day Setting: 14:00
Weather: Mid Clear
Start: Standing
Tyre wear: Normal
Fuel consumption: Normal
Pit-stops: None required

Server track settings:
SESSION_START=97
RANDOMNESS=0
LAP_GAIN=25
SESSION_TRANSFER=60

Damage: 70%

Server: simracing.org.uk
Password: Our usual practise password

All drivers must be booked in to race before booking closes at 20:15 UK time.

IMPORTANT: The PLP app VERSION 1.1 /(http://www.assettocorsa.net/forum/index.php?threads/a-pit-lane-penalty-app-for-repeated-track-cutting-0-9.17852)) is required. The file is an attachment on the first message, download and install as it is.
The string that is posted in chat when you join should read: "PLP:running version 1.1,3-50-3-True-1.3-0.9-3" - if it doesn't, then you will be excluded from the results.

Traction Control = Higher the number the more slip is allowed.. so for more traction control use a lower number, for a looser car use a higher number.
